5. An extension cord should not be used unless absolutely necessary. Use of an

improper extension cord can result in risk of fire or electric shock. If using an

extension cord make sure that:
A) The pins on the plug of the extension cord are the same number, size and

shape as those on the plug on the charger.
B) The extension cord is properly wired and in good working condition.
C) The wire size is the same or larger than the ones specified below:

Recommended size of Extension Cord for Battery Charger
Length of Cord (Feet) 25

50

100

150

AWG Size of Cord*

18

18

16

14

* The smaller the AWG (American Wire Gauge) number of the extension cord,

the higher the capacity of the cable for conducting current to ensure proper us-

age of the tool.

6. Do not operate charger with a damaged cord or plug.
7. Do not operate the charger if it has received a sharp blow, been dropped or

damaged in any other way.
8. Do not open the drill, battery or battery charger. There are no user serviceable

parts. Opening the unit will void the warranty.
9. Unplug the charger from its power source when not in use.
10. Do not touch the terminals inside the battery charger with any other metal

object such as nails or coins. This can short the charger.
11. Do not store the unit in areas where the temperature can exceed 120°F.
12. Do not throw the battery or battery charger in fire.

This can cause an explosion.
13. WARNING: Batteries vent hydrogen gas and may explode in the presence of

a source of ignition, such as a pilot light. To reduce the risk of serious personal

injury, never use any cordless product in the presence of an open flame.

An exploded battery can propel debris and chemicals. If exposed, flush with

water immediately for a minimum of 10 minutes and seek medical attention.
14. During extreme conditions, the battery may leak. This does not indicate a

battery failure. However, if the liquid gets on your skin, immediately wash with

soap and water, neutralize the area with a mild acid such as lemon juice or

vinegar. If the liquid gets into your eyes, flush them with clean water immedi-

ately for a minimum of 10 minutes and seek medical attention.

Service
1. Tool service must be performed only by qualified repair personnel.

2. When servicing a tool, use only identical replacement parts. Follow

instructions in the Maintenance section of this manual. Use of unauthorized

parts or failure to follow Maintenance Instructions may create a risk of shock or

injury.
3. WARNING: This product contains chemicals, including lead, known to the

State of California to cause cancer, and birth defects or other reproductive harm.

SPECIFIC SAFETY RULES AND/OR SYMBOLS
1. Hold tool by insulated gripping surfaces when performing an operation where

the cutting tool may contact hidden wiring. Contact with a “live” wire will also

make exposed metal parts of the tool “live” and shock the operator.
2. Keep hands clear of moving parts.
3. Do not touch moving parts.
Allow the power tool accessories (bit and blades

etc.) to cool before touching them. They can become extremely hot during use

and can burn your skin.

IMPORTANT S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S FOR BATTERY CHARGER:
1. This manual includes important safety instructions for the battery charger.

Fully read all instructions and warning labels before using the battery or battery

charger.
2. Do NOT expose the battery or battery charger to rain or moisture.
3. Use of any attachment not recommended in this manual may result in the risk

of fire, electric shock or injury to person and will void the warranty.
4. To reduce the risk of damaging the battery charger power cord, be sure to

pull the plug rather then the cord when disconnecting it from the power supply.

Always position the cord so it will not be stepped on or tripped over. This will

prevent damage to the cord.
